The biggest shake-up in the college football playoff rankings has taken place as the top four teams were released, a group that now includes two new teams.

Clemson and Alabama remain in the top two spots but leaving the top four is Notre Dame who struggled to beat Boston College last Saturday and Ohio State who lost to Michigan State. Taking their place is Oklahoma who steps into the number three spot following impressive back-to-back wins over Baylor and TCU. Iowa moves up one spot to number five as the Hawkeyes remain unbeaten at 11-0.

The first two out are Michigan State who holds the number five spot and Notre Dame who dropped to number six.

Below is the new top 10 rankings.
1. Clemson
2. Alabama
3. Oklahoma
4. Iowa
5. Michigan State
6. Notre Dame
7. Baylor
8. Ohio St.
9. Stanford
10. Michigan
